How they compare

Germany currently reports 390.29 million kg against 222,981 kg in Micronesia (Federated States of), a difference of 390.07 million kg.

That makes Germany's figure about 1,750.3 times Micronesia (Federated States of)'s.

Across all 33 years both countries report, Germany has been ahead every year.

Germany ranks 15th and Micronesia (Federated States of) ranks 18th of 190 countries.

Germany has averaged higher in every one of the 4 decades both report.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
